由于 SMB 广播导致 Synology NAS 休眠问题

由于 SMB 广播导致 Synology NAS 休眠问题

我是又一个在重复这个循环的用户。我购买了 Synology NAS DS718+,安装了 Plex 和 Docker (calibre-web-server),发现 NAS 一直处于休眠状态。

在查看了 Synology 自己的建议后解决休眠问题,我停止了Plex和Docker包,并拔掉了网线。

这(即拔掉电源)解决了问题,表明问题出在网络上。通过非正式清单我;

  • 禁用 DHCP 并静态分配本地 IPv4 地址
  • 完全禁用 IPv6
  • 在路由器上禁用 UPnP
  • 在 NAS 上禁用 QuickConnect 和 NAME.synology.me DDNS 访问,并阻止路由器上转发的端口
  • 更改了工作组名称
  • 关闭 Windows 服务发现(但网络上没有 Windows 设备)

这些都不起作用;然而,我注意到有时NAS 将进入休眠状态 - 但似乎只是一夜之间(可能是因为网络更安静,即 LAN 上的所有其他联网设备都没有使用?)。

因此我接着说道:

  • 禁用所有文件服务,包括 SMB、AFP、SSH、FTP。

这似乎有效地解决了问题。然而,当我重新打开 SMB 时,问题又出现了。

我使用 WireShark 发现它每 5 分钟发送一次广播。我想知道这是否是部分原因 - 我想知道为什么会发生这种情况 - 以及如何阻止它?

如果您查看屏幕截图,您会发现,尽管没有系统对它们做出响应,但这似乎还是每 5 分钟发生一次。

WireShark 屏幕截图

是什么导致了这种行为 - 我可以通过哪些途径来纠正这个问题 - 这可能是它不会休眠的原因之一吗?

如果我可以提供任何其他信息,或者可以采取任何其他步骤来找出导致 HDD 持续活动的原因,请毫不犹豫地将它们与答案一起提出来!

提前谢谢了

更新日期:2020 年 4 月 29 日

我编辑了 smb.conf 文件以包含keepalive=0deadtime=1。这没有什么区别。

我也尝试完全关闭 SMB 服务 - 但广播仍在进行!

相关内容